Group G:The last of the 6 team groups, were going to continue to stir the pot here. We like Spain to top the group, which is fine. But after that, we like Albania to unseat Italy for the 2nd spot in this group. Not only do we not project Italy to top the group, we dont even think they make the playoffs! Now surely this seems irrational given history, but Albania is a very, very good team. Theyve beaten some of the top teams in the world over the past year, and they look very strong. They lost 1-0 at Italy recently, so its not crazy to think theyre pretty even on a neutral ground. Israel and Macedonia got a tough draw here, and anything more than 4th place would be a little surprising. But dont sleep on Albania.

Group F:Surely, were about to stir the pot. England must feel thrilled drawing Slovakia, Scotland, and Slovenia. It seems like this should be a runaway for England. But our rankings dont think so. Not only do they not think itll be a runaway, they like Scotland to come out and top the group! And at 55%! Now this is an awful ambitious prediction, but its certainly feasible. We give England an 81% chance to finish top 2 in the group, but still, to not project them at the top is quite the move. Slovakia and Slovenia to us were among the weakest in their respective pots, so its not a surprise to see these results.

Group H:Belgium made out like bandits at the draw. They got Bosnia, who was the weakest team in Pot 2. They got Greece, who was the weakest team in Pot 3. And they got Estonia, among the weakest in Pot 4. Belgium is one of the best teams in the world, and we give them an over 96% chance to top the group. We really expect them to clean house, and didnt run a single simulation where they finished worse than 2nd. This is bad news for the other teams in the group, as failing to take any points against Belgium will really hurt qualifying for the playoffs. We expect the team that misses the playoffs to come from this group.

Group C:Nobody in this group should really give Germany much trouble in qualifying. Northern Ireland and Czech Republic are both quality, improving teams. But theyre not Germany. We dont project any team to finish with higher than Germanys 26.44 points in qualifying and give them an 89% chance to top the group. After that, Azerbaijan and San Marino shouldnt do much. So its the two aforementioned teams and Norway likely fighting for a spot in the playoffs. We currently give the slightest of margins to Northern Ireland, but would bet on it being them or the Czechs going to the playoffs.

We definitely value more recent results highly (18 months), so theres definitely a good amount of movement unlike other rankings. Ultimately, Slovakia got a manageable group. Could have done worse than drawing England. If the results come, were ok with being incorrect.

Slovakias lower ranking (theyre 40) is largely due to their strength of schedule and location of matches. Only 3 teams in UEFA have played a weaker schedule. Also their 1 goal win over Spain was at home. By contrast, Wales road victory over Belgium was much more impressive in our eyes due to opponent quality and match location.
